Courtesy Veronica Cantu, (Laredo, Tx)-Several members of the City’s law enforcement community joined students at Alexander High School for lunch. This is because the District will now offer free lunch to law enforcement officials who want to eat at UISD campuses. The individual needs to be in full uniform and present credentials to front office

(Laredo, Tx)-The Christen Middle School 7th Grade Gold Football Team started their season with a win over rivals Lamar Middle School scoring the only touchdown of the game early in the fourth quarter to win by a score of 6-0. The game was played on Saturday morning at the Kawas Elementary Football Field.
